Output 34eab19652b9931cfdf293823518d396f90e0d9751c375e0d4c9fa476b987128:7

value
34239934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a55a626066bf6e14b15e3977ce10ceaf5a60ccd OP_EQUAL
address
MAJQQR5CXDTtF4W1ZuqV4vsoLzqtZUas3z
transaction
34eab19652b9931cfdf293823518d396f90e0d9751c375e0d4c9fa476b987128
spent
true